Snakes and ladders : levers, obstacles and solutions to Putting Evidence into Practice : second interim report of the North Thames Purchaser Led Implementation Projects
In the spring of 1996, the Implementation Group of North Thames Research and Development allocated £50000 to each of thirteen health authorities for evidence into practice implementation projects. In autumn 1996, the King's Fund Management College was commissioned to evaluate the 17 approved projects. This is the second of three evaluation reports, and deals with levers, barriers and strategies to overcome obstacles. It aims to present the generalisable lessons on levers, obstacles and solutions, and to provide progress reports on the sixteen projects.
